Q: Is 42,525,114 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 42,525,114 is not a prime number.

Why is 42,525,114 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 42525114 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 23 46 69 138 308,153 616,306 924,459 1,848,918 7,087,519 14,175,038 21,262,557 and 42,525,114, with no remainder.

Since 42,525,114 cannot be divided by just 1 and 42,525,114, it is not a prime number.
